Pricing
Enaex
Contact
Sergio Undurraga Saavedra is on the Board of Directors at Enaex.
This person is not in the org chart
This person is not in any teams
This person is not in any offices
Sakura
Fractal
Al-Futtaim
HDR
Unity Five Ltd (Zatpark)
View more